Technical Momentum and Indicator Analysis
Recent technical evaluations indicate a complex picture for Indef Manufacturing Ltd. The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) on the weekly chart remains bearish, signalling sustained downward momentum. Although the monthly MACD reading is not explicitly defined, the weekly bearishness suggests that the stock’s medium-term trend is under pressure.
The Relative Strength Index (RSI) presents a mixed signal: weekly RSI is bullish, indicating some short-term buying interest, while the monthly RSI is bearish, reflecting longer-term weakness. This divergence suggests that while short-term traders may find opportunities, the overall momentum remains subdued.
Bollinger Bands on the weekly timeframe are mildly bearish, implying that price volatility is skewed towards the downside, but not excessively so. Daily moving averages reinforce the bearish stance, with the stock trading below key averages, signalling that the immediate trend favours sellers.
The Know Sure Thing (KST) indicator on the weekly chart is bearish, further confirming the negative momentum. Dow Theory assessments align with this view, showing mildly bearish trends on both weekly and monthly scales. Meanwhile, On-Balance Volume (OBV) readings are neutral on the weekly chart but bullish monthly, suggesting that volume flows may be supporting a longer-term accumulation phase despite short-term price weakness.
Price Action and Volatility
On 30 Jul 2026, Indef Manufacturing Ltd’s price fluctuated between ₹212.00 and ₹237.80, closing at ₹234.05, up from the previous close of ₹230.65. This intraday volatility reflects investor uncertainty amid the prevailing bearish technical backdrop. The stock remains significantly below its 52-week high of ₹449.00, underscoring the steep correction it has undergone over the past year.
Comparing the stock’s returns with the broader Sensex index highlights the challenges faced by Indef Manufacturing Ltd. Over the past week, the stock declined by 0.34%, while Sensex gained 1.17%. The one-month return for the stock was a negative 6.72%, contrasting with Sensex’s positive 1.21%. Year-to-date, the stock has plunged 30.35%, markedly underperforming the Sensex’s 8.88% decline. Over the last year, the stock’s return was a steep negative 44.52%, compared to Sensex’s modest 4.53% loss.

Long-Term Performance and Sector Context
Indef Manufacturing Ltd’s long-term returns are notably weak compared to the Sensex benchmark. While the Sensex has delivered a 17.37% return over three years and an impressive 176.82% over ten years, Indef Manufacturing’s corresponding figures are unavailable but implied to be significantly lower given recent performance. This underperformance highlights structural challenges within the company or sector-specific headwinds impacting industrial manufacturing stocks.
Investors should also consider the broader industrial manufacturing sector’s dynamics, which can be influenced by macroeconomic factors such as commodity prices, infrastructure spending, and global supply chain conditions. Indef Manufacturing’s technical deterioration may reflect these external pressures alongside company-specific issues.
